Dubai World Cup Auction & Exhibition
March 28, 2007
 
The Dubai Racing Club in conjunction with the Courtyard Gallery and Art Connection, presented the first ever Dubai World Cup Art Auction and Exhibition, in Al Joharah Ballroom at the Madinat Jumeirah Resort.

Eleven artists from around the world were commissioned to create and exhibit a piece that represents each of the the 11 winners of the Dubai World Cup. A select audience was invited to bid for each piece of art, with part of the proceeds going to the Al Saada Girl’s School, which cares for neglected children and orphans.

An exhibition also ran alongside the auction, whereby the 11 appointed artists also displayed two other pieces each, with an equine theme.

The auction was overseen by Phillips de Pury and Company. Founded in 1796 in London, this auction house and art dealership has offices in many cities around the world, including New York, London, Geneva, Berlin, Brussels and Paris.

All art works were presented in a limited edition book sold both in the UAE and abroad.
